This St. Louis weekend is filled with family friendly events from air shows to art fairs



ST. LOUIS — Take a glimpse at the upcoming events happening in June 8 and 9 2024 in St. Louis, St. Louis County and the surrounding area. These events range from air shows to cultural celebrations and family-friendly festivals.
